Nervite Dosage & How to Take

This is the usual dosage recommended in most common treatment cases. Please remember that every patient and their case is different, so the dosage can be different based on the disease, route of administration, patient's age and medical history.

Find the right dosage based on disease and age

Age Group Dosage
Adult
  • Disease:
  • Before or After Meal: Either
  • Single Maximum Dose: 1 Tablet
  • Dosage Form: Tablet
  • Dosage Route: Oral
  • Frequency: 1 daily
  • Course Duration: As directed by the doctor
  • Special Instructions: strength 75 mg pregabalin and 10 mg nortriptyline, use in chronic low back pain

Nervite Related Warnings

  • Is the use of Nervite safe for pregnant women?


    Nervite may cause moderate side effects during pregnancy. If you feel its harmful effects, then stop taking this drug immediately, and do not take Nervite again without your doctor's advice.

  • Is the use of Nervite safe during breastfeeding?


    Taking Nervite may lead to serious side effects if you are breastfeeding. Nervite should not be taken by breastfeeding women unless prescribed by the doctor.

  • What is the effect of Nervite on the Kidneys?


    Nervite does not damage the kidneys.

  • What is the effect of Nervite on the Liver?


    Very few cases of side effects of Nervite on the liver have been reported.

  • What is the effect of Nervite on the Heart?


    Side effects of Nervite rarely affect the heart.
